以下是提高ResNet精度的一些方法:

  1. 使用更深的网络结构:可以增加ResNet的层数,例如使用ResNet-152。

  2. 数据增强:可以通过旋转、翻转、剪裁等方式增加训练数据的多样性,从而提高模型的鲁棒性。

  3. 学习率调整:可以使用学习率衰减策略,例如余弦退火或学习率多项式衰减,来提高模型的学习效率和准确度。

  4. 批量归一化:可以在ResNet中添加批量归一化层,以加速收敛并提高模型的稳定性。

  5. 优化器选择:可以尝试使用不同的优化器,例如Adam和SGD等,以获得更好的结果。

  6. 集成学习:可以使用多个ResNet模型进行集成学习,例如使用投票或平均方法来获得更好的性能。

  7. 模型微调:可以使用预训练的ResNet模型进行微调,例如在ImageNet数据集上预训练的模型,以适应特定的任务和数据集。


原文地址: https://www.cveoy.top/t/topic/bwzO 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录